**Action item (FUEL-22):** The Cartwheel fleet fuel report double-counted refuels logged within short intervals. Contractor onboarding note: the dedup window and sampling rates live in config, not code. Fix merges duplicate events and regenerates October reports. Do not change values without sign-off. Current constants follow.

tuning table, fawip-fahag:
WEIGHTS = {
    "novwyn": 452,
    "casdor": 675,
}

Ticket QX-2209: Exports from the Meridale report tool shifted all timestamps by one hour after the credential for the Clockvane timezone service expired. Support should tell affected customers that historical exports regenerated after today are correct. We carefully re-verified DST boundaries against three sample regions. The replacement key for the Clockvane service is provided immediately below.

gateway credential: kto3_qfe

Q: A thumbnail job is stuck in the Fernbright queue. What now?

Check the worker pool first. Stuck jobs usually mean a poisoned source image; the decoder retries three times, then parks the job in the dead-letter shelf. Purge parked jobs older than 24h with the sweep command. Do not restart the queue broker during business hours — in-flight renders are lost. Runbook, retry semantics, and the sweep flags are documented on the internal page.

wiki page, tahaf-tajog: https://jira.ordindyn.corp/pipeline